Position:
Automotive Technician Responsibilities:
Diagnose, repair, and maintain automobiles and light trucks in accordance with dealership and manufacturer standards
Perform routine maintenance services such as oil changes, tire rotations, brake inspections, and fluid checks
Inspect and test vehicles for mechanical and electrical issues using diagnostic tools and equipment
Communicate findings and repair recommendations clearly to service advisors and customers
Complete repairs including, but not limited to, engine, transmission, steering, suspension, braking, heating, cooling, and electrical systems
Document all services and repairs performed, maintaining accurate records in compliance with regulations
Stay current with manufacturer technical updates, recalls, and service bulletins
Maintain a clean and organized work environment, adhering to safety protocols
Actively participate in ongoing training and professional development opportunities
Collaborate with team members to ensure efficient workflow and high-quality customer service
Qualifications:
High school diploma or equivalent; completion of automotive technical training preferred
